The purpose of this paper is to analyze the modified three-step iterative scheme for solving nonlinear operator equations in real Banach spaces. Our results can be viewed as an extension of three-step and two-step iterative schemes of Glowinski and Le Tallec [R. Glowinski, P. Le Tallec, Augemented Lagrangian and Operator-Splitting Methods in Nonlinear Mechanics, SIAM Publishing Co., Philadelphia, 1989] Noor [M.A. Noor, Three-step iterative algorithms for multivalued quasi variational inclusions, J. Math. Anal. Appl. 255 (2001) 589–604; M.A. Noor, Some predictor–corrector algorithms for multivalued variational inequalities, J. Optim. Theory Appl. 108 (3) (2001) 659–670; M.A. Noor, T.M. Rassias, Z. Huang, Three-step iterations for nonlinear accretive operator equations, J. Math. Anal. Appl. 274 (2002) 59–68] and Ishikawa [S. Ishikawa, Fixed points by a new iteration method, Proc. Amer. Math. Soc. 44 (1974) 147–150].
